Bishunpur

Bishunpur is a village located in Tardih subdivision of Darbhanga district in Bihar, India. It is situated 2km away from sub-district headquarter Tardih (tehsildar office) and 45km away from district headquarter Darbhanga. As per 2009 stats, Kakodha is the gram panchayat of Bishunpur village.

About Bishunpur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bishunpur is 227191. The village spans a total geographical area of 109 hectares. Jhanjharpur is nearest town to Bishunpur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 11km away.

Population of Bishunpur

According to the 2011 Census, Bishunpur has a total population of about 1,019, with approximately 539 males and 480 females. The sex ratio is around 890 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 135 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 6 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 72.52%, with male literacy at about 80.15% and female literacy near 63.96%. There are around 244 households in the village. Connectivity of Bishunpur

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bishunpur. As per the 2011 stats, Bishunpur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 5 - 10 km distance
